sofi Day 2 Ends

Flavor trends, enticing products and a lot of sauces and condiments

As Day 2 of the sofi Awards judging comes to a close, the panel tasted its way through 126 Cooking Sauces and Flavor Enhancers then moved on to 69 Condiments. That’s a lot of sauces, mustards and chutneys even for professionals so, happily, the day ended with Baked Good, Baking Ingredients or Cereal—60 different cakes, cookies and other treats.  In total, the judges went through 522 products today in 10 categories.

The foodspring team managed once again to sneak into the tasting rooms, and we noticed a few more interesting trends (and enticing products) that grabbed our attention. Among them:

  • Chocolate tea: Products ran the gamut from lightly cocoa-scented teas to chocolate-infused tea drinks. All in all, a sweet addition to these herbal and spiced drinks.
  • Single-purpose oils: Some oils are touting themselves as the best for certain uses, such as wok oils for stir-frying, “dip-and-toss” oils for bread-dipping and pasta-dressing, and flavored popcorn oils for—you guessed it—popcorn-popping.
  • Unexpected Lentil: From cereals to chips to crackers, lentils are being used in new ways.
  • Apple flavor: Yesterday we saw apple as a new flavor favorite in jams and crackers (See Day 1 Flavor Trends and Combinations) and the same is true in cooking sauces and condiments. Products included a harvest apple barbecue sauce, tart apple cooking sauce, an apple pepper jack wing sauce, maple apple compote and harvest apple berry chutney.
  • Oils beyond the olive: From flax and green tea to white truffle and black walnut, some brands are bottling the versatile cooking condiment from foods you didn’t even know had oil.

  
The last day of judging tomorrow will be a packed one. Among categories still to go are Meat, Pate & Seafood; Pasta Sauce; Confection; Appetizer, Antipasto, Salsa or Dip; and Frozen Savory. And that’s on top of 106 Snack Foods and 103 Chocolates. (We’ll definitely be nearby for that last one.)
